#27 The entry-level Ham Radio 'Technician' classification does not require the Morse Code test, Besoeker.

It only requires a 35-question written test on basic radio theory, regulations and operating practices.

Skidmark is correct, too. Analog encrypted data streaming would be allowed for that license on certain frequencies, and not generally monitored.
